What are the ingredients in Arizona green tea ginseng and honey?
From the Package. PREMIUM BREWED BLEND OF GREEN TEAS USING FILTERED WATER, HIGH FRUCTOSE CORN SYRUP (GLUCOSE-FRUCTOSE SYRUP), HONEY, CITRIC ACID, NATURAL FLAVORS, ASCORBIC ACID (VITAMIN C), GINSENG ROOT EXTRACT. Green tea and ginseng are both ancient medicinal plants with purported healing properties. However, with 17 grams of sugar in the form of high fructose corn syrup and honey, AriZona Tea’s popular version is the equivalent of tea-flavored sugar water.It is very relaxing. Is Arizona green tea with honey healthy for you?
Arizona green tea is a sweetened drink that combines green tea and other flavors such as honey or ginseng. Like traditional green tea, it contains antioxidants that may support overall health. However, Arizona green tea also includes sugar and other additives, which could offset some of its benefits. Can I lose weight by drinking Arizona green tea? While green tea with moderate sugar might support weight management alongside a balanced diet, Arizona green tea’s sugar content may contribute extra calories that could hinder weight loss efforts.
